Job Description:
As a Carpenter at Mitchell Construction Group, LLC, you will play a crucial role in executing various construction tasks, ensuring that all work is completed to the highest standards. You will work on a range of projects, from new constructions to renovations, and will be responsible for interpreting construction drawings, measuring, cutting, and installing materials.
Key Responsibilities:
- Read and interpret drawings, and sketches to determine project specifications and requirements.
- Measure, cut, and shape wood, plastic, and other materials using hand tools and power tools.
- Assemble and install structures and fixtures such as frameworks, floors, and cabinets.
- Inspect and replace damaged framework or other structures and fixtures.
- Collaborate with other construction professionals, including project managers and subcontractors, to ensure timely project completion.
- Maintain a clean and organized work environment, adhering to all safety guidelines and regulations.
- Manage and maintain tools and equipment in good working condition.
